My husband and I booked a room here on a cross-country trip, and it was our absolute worst lodging experience ever, bar none!

The motel office looked like it might once have been a fast-food restaurant. It smelled of stale urine, or stale urine mixed with the odor of cheap incense. I noticed a long handwritten list of people not to rent to. We walked up the exterior stairs and hallway to our second-floor room. Some sleazy-looking guy sat outside his room on a cooler drinking a beer.

Our room was awful. A hair clip held the sagging drapes closed. Someone had previously slammed the front door into the wall, leaving a deep imprint of the door handle. The lock on the bathroom door was busted. The bathroom floor felt greasy. The soles of my brand-new white socks turned black.

We slept on top of the sheets, in our street clothes. It was never dark in our room, because there was a security spotlight focused directly on our window, and the miserable drapes weren't worth a darn. A freight train blew its horn right across the street, jolting us from our fitful sleep. It was the worst night's sleep we'd ever had. My husband said the shower was serviceable, but I decided not to shower the next morning. We couldn't wait to get the heck out of there in the morning.

All this for sixty bucks, can you believe it? The place has the aura of a motel that rents by the hour, if you know what I mean. I am definitely going to lodge a complaint with Choice Hotels Int'l.

And I will never again book lodgings without checking the Trip Advisor ratings!
